About Event

Most LLMs are bad at news. They give you outdated information, miss coverage entirely, and point to sources you can't verify.

Connecting your LLM directly to a news API fixes that. You ask questions in plain language and get back real articles with the sources attached.

In this session, Joshua Dziabiak (Founder & CEO @ Perigon) will walk through how to connect Perigon's API and MCP server to the AI tools you already use.

We'll get into:

  1. How to connect Perigon's MCP server to Claude, ChatGPT, or your own agent.

  2. What you can actually pull: articles, journalists, sources, companies, people, sentiment, and story clusters.

  3. How to write prompts that return usable, sourced results.

  4. How to build a repeatable setup your team can use day to day.

After this session, you'll be able to do this kind of research just by asking:

  1. Reporter research: who covers your space, what they've published lately, and how they frame it.

  2. Competitive coverage: how your client stacks up against everyone else in their category.

  3. Topic research: which outlets own a subject, and whether it's climbing or fading.

  4. Story tracking: who broke it, who followed, and who's getting quoted.
